Basketball player-sized cellist guests with TSOMay 13, 2021 · Tucson —The Tucson Symphony Orchestra has named Paul Meecham as its President and Chief Executive Officer, effective May 17, 2021. Meecham is a nationally-known symphony executive who has served as the CEO of the Utah Symphony & Opera (2016–2019), CEO of the Baltimore Symphony Orchestra (2006–2016) and Executive Director of the Seattle Symphony (2004–2006). The Tucson Symphony Orchestra Chorus is a volunteer ensemble under the direction of Dr. Marcela Molina. The Tucson Symphony Orchestra Chorus was founded by Bruce Chamberlain in 2003. Since then, the Chorus has given critically acclaimed performances of Handel’s Messiah, Beethoven’s Symphony No. 9 and Missa Solemnis, Mozart and Brahm’s ... Support.Tucson Symphony Orchestra is proud to be a partner in the National Alliance for Audition Support (NAAS), an unprecedented national initiative to increase diversity in American orchestras. The Alliance does so by offering Black and Latinx musicians a customized combination of mentoring, audition preparation, financial support, and audition previews.Tucson Symphony Orchestra hosts many concerts and community events throughout southern Arizona. The Tucson Symphony Orchestra, or TSO, is the primary professional orchestra of Tucson, Arizona. Founded in 1928, when the season consisted of just two concerts, the TSO is the oldest continuously running performing arts organization in the Southwest.
